Sarah Kim
Teaching piano is teaching how music works.
Sarah Kim trained at Berklee College of Music with a focus on contemporary piano performance and music education. After graduating, she spent three years teaching at a Boston music school before relocating to Raleigh in 2011, where she founded Harmony Music Academy.
She teaches students from age 5 through adult, adapting fluidly between classical foundational work, contemporary pop repertoire, jazz harmony, and music theory for students who want to understand how music is constructed. Sarah believes strongly that theory should serve the music a student wants to make — not the other way around.
In 12 years of teaching, Sarah has seen students go on to study music in college, perform original compositions at local venues, and — perhaps most importantly — develop a genuine lifelong relationship with the piano that began in a 30-minute lesson at age six.
